The Merzouga dunes are honestly one of those places that just hits differently. Standing out there surrounded by endless sand feels unreal, like you’ve landed on another planet. The dunes go on forever, and watching the sun rise or set over them is something I’ll never forget — the colours change every minute and it’s ridiculously beautiful. Riding camels through the dunes is a bit touristy but actually really chill, and spending the night in a desert camp was a highlight. Sitting around a fire, hearing nothing but the wind, then looking up and seeing a sky full of stars is such a cool experience. It gets seriously hot during the day, so plan around that, but overall Merzouga is peaceful, humbling and 100% worth the trip. I’d do it again in a heartbeat.

Merzouga is a small desert village in southeastern Morocco, famous for its proximity to the Erg Chebbi dunes, some of the largest and most spectacular sand dunes in the country. It lies about 50 km from Erfoud and close to the Algerian border. ✨ Highlights of Merzouga: 🏜️ Erg Chebbi dunes: Towering golden dunes that can reach up to 150 meters, offering stunning sunrise and sunset views. 🐪 Camel trekking: One of the most popular activities, where visitors ride camels into the dunes and spend the night in desert camps under the stars. 🎶 Berber culture: The area is home to Amazigh (Berber) communities, where you can experience traditional music, food, and hospitality. 🏍️ Adventure activities: Sandboarding, quad biking, and 4x4 tours across the desert. 🐦 Dayet Srij Lake: A seasonal lake near Merzouga that attracts flamingos and other migratory birds when it fills with water. Merzouga is often included in Morocco’s desert tours, typically starting from Marrakech or Fes, making it a must-visit for travelers seeking the Sahara desert experience.

Erg Chebbi is one of Morocco’s most famous desert landscapes — a stunning sea of golden sand dunes rising dramatically from the flat desert floor. Some dunes reach up to 150 meters, creating a breathtaking horizon that constantly shifts with the wind. It lies near the town of Merzouga in southeastern Morocco, very close to the Algeria border. On clear days, you can sense how close the border is — the desert feels wide, open, and endless. What makes Erg Chebbi unforgettable: • The sand dunes They stretch for more than 20 kilometers, with soft, fine sand that glows orange at sunrise and deep red at sunset. The shapes change daily with the wind, giving the landscape a magical, almost surreal quality. • Camel rides Visitors often enter the dunes on camelback, especially at sunset or sunrise. The slow movement of the camels across the sand makes the experience peaceful and almost timeless. • Desert camps Many travelers stay overnight in Berber desert camps. These camps are usually simple but very comfortable — traditional tents, warm blankets, delicious meals, music around the fire, and a sky full of stars that feels impossibly close. • Hospitality The local Amazigh (Berber) people are known for their kindness and generosity. They prepare tea, share stories, guide visitors safely through the dunes, and make every guest feel completely welcome. • Surroundings Because the area is open and vast, you can feel the edge of the Sahara stretching toward Algeria. It’s one of the places where you truly understand the scale and silence of the desert.
